RumbaTap
Spring
This class offers students different ways to access their inner rhythm machine and to explore the most immediate and natural physical outlets for the music in their mind. Improvisation will be part of this process. Although some tap technique will be covered and incorporated, the class focuses on body percussion/rhythmic coordination and a general understanding of the earth-shattering power of Afro-Cuban culture, music, and dance.
